Analysis
In 2025, historical exposure to drought — land soil moisture anomaly in Central Estonia stood at 5.95 Percentage change.
Compared with earlier readings it is up 1,472.7% on the previous year and up 111.7% over ten years.
Over the whole period, historical exposure to drought — land soil moisture anomaly in Central Estonia peaked at 10.65 Percentage change in 1981 and was at its lowest, -12.1 Percentage change, in 2002.
That places Central Estonia 122nd out of 3127 regions with data for 2025, putting it in the top 10%.
The series is highly variable year to year, so single readings are best treated with caution.

About this data
The dataset provides annual anomalies in land and cropland soil moisture content of the top soil layer (0 to 7 cm) compared to the reference period 1981-2010. Exposure indicators to drought have been prepared by the Organisation for Economic Co-operation and Development (OECD). Please see the working paper for a more complete description of the methods. The datasets span the period 1981-2024 and is the result of the use of a variety of geospatial data sources, including the ERA5-Land averaged monthly data of volumetric soil moisture and ESA CCI land cover data. Average anomalies have been calculated for both land and cropland exposure to drought. The dataset has a global coverage on a national level; on the sub-national TL2 level (i.e. large subnational regions) results are reported for all OECD countries as well as for Argentina, Brazil, China, India, Indonesia and South Africa. A number of aggregates are included: Euro area, European Union, Advanced economies, Emerging market economies, G7, G20, OECD, OECD Europe, OECD Asia Oceania, OECD Americas and the LAC region.
